Best Task Management Apps for Android and iOS: A Comprehensive Comparison
In today's fast-paced world, staying organised is more crucial than ever. Task management apps have become indispensable tools for individuals and teams alike, helping to streamline workflows, track progress, and ensure nothing falls through the cracks. With a plethora of options available on both Android and iOS platforms, choosing the right app can feel overwhelming. This article provides a detailed comparison of the top task management applications, highlighting their key features, pricing models, user interface, integration capabilities, and mobile accessibility to help you make an informed decision.
Feature Comparison: To-Do Lists, Reminders, Collaboration
Different task management apps offer varying functionalities to cater to diverse needs. Let's delve into some of the most important features:
To-Do Lists: The core functionality of any task management app is the ability to create and manage to-do lists. Apps differ in how they allow you to structure these lists. Some offer simple, linear lists, while others provide more advanced options like nested subtasks, project-based organisation, and the ability to add tags or categories.
Simple Lists: Suitable for basic task tracking. Examples include Google Tasks and Microsoft To Do.
Advanced Lists: Ideal for complex projects with multiple dependencies. Examples include Todoist, Asana, and Trello.
Reminders: Setting reminders ensures you never miss a deadline. The effectiveness of reminders depends on their customisability and reliability. Consider whether the app allows you to set recurring reminders, location-based reminders, and snooze options.
Basic Reminders: Date and time-based reminders are standard. Most apps offer this.
Advanced Reminders: Location-based and recurring reminders provide added flexibility. Apps like Todoist and Any.do excel here.
Collaboration: For teams, collaboration features are essential. These features enable users to share tasks, assign responsibilities, track progress collectively, and communicate within the app.
Shared Lists: Basic collaboration allowing multiple users to view and edit the same list. Common in many apps.
Task Assignment: Assigning tasks to specific team members with deadlines and progress tracking. Asana and Trello are strong in this area.
Communication: Built-in communication tools like comments and direct messaging facilitate seamless collaboration. Some apps integrate with other communication platforms like Slack.
Here's a brief comparison of some popular apps based on these features:
| App | To-Do Lists | Reminders | Collaboration |
|--------------|-------------|-----------|---------------|
| Todoist | Advanced | Advanced | Shared Lists, Task Assignment, Comments |
| Asana | Advanced | Basic | Shared Lists, Task Assignment, Communication |
| Trello | Advanced | Basic | Shared Lists, Task Assignment, Comments |
| Google Tasks | Simple | Basic | Shared Lists |
| Microsoft To Do | Simple | Basic | Shared Lists, Task Assignment |
| Any.do | Advanced | Advanced | Shared Lists, Task Assignment, Comments |
Pricing Models: Free vs. Paid Options
Task management apps typically offer a free version with limited features and a paid subscription for access to premium functionalities. Understanding the pricing models is crucial for selecting an app that aligns with your budget and requirements.
Free Options: Free versions usually provide basic to-do list management, reminders, and limited collaboration features. These are suitable for individuals with simple task management needs.
Paid Options: Paid subscriptions unlock advanced features such as unlimited projects, advanced filters, customisable themes, priority support, and more robust collaboration tools. These are ideal for teams and individuals with complex workflows.
Here's a general overview of the pricing models for some popular apps:
Todoist: Offers a free plan with limited features. Premium plans unlock advanced features like reminders, file uploads, and project history. They also offer a business plan for teams.
Asana: Provides a free plan for small teams. Paid plans offer more advanced features like custom fields, dependencies, and reporting. Learn more about Workdue and how we can help you integrate Asana into your workflow.
Trello: Offers a free plan with unlimited boards. Paid plans unlock features like advanced checklists, custom backgrounds, and priority support.
Google Tasks: Completely free with a Google account, offering basic task management features.
Microsoft To Do: Free with a Microsoft account, providing simple task management and integration with other Microsoft services.
Any.do: Offers a free plan with basic features. Premium plans unlock recurring tasks, location-based reminders, and unlimited collaboration.
Consider your needs carefully before opting for a paid plan. Evaluate whether the additional features justify the cost. Many apps offer free trials, allowing you to test the premium features before committing to a subscription.
User Interface and User Experience
The user interface (UI) and user experience (UX) significantly impact the ease of use and overall satisfaction with a task management app. A well-designed app should be intuitive, visually appealing, and efficient to navigate.
Intuitive Design: The app should be easy to understand and use, even for beginners. Clear navigation, logical organisation, and helpful tooltips contribute to an intuitive design.
Visual Appeal: A visually appealing interface can enhance engagement and motivation. Consider the app's colour scheme, typography, and overall aesthetic.
Customisability: The ability to customise the app's appearance and functionality can improve the user experience. Look for options to change themes, adjust font sizes, and configure notifications.
Ease of Navigation: Seamless navigation is crucial for efficient task management. The app should allow you to quickly access different sections, create new tasks, and manage existing ones. Consider our services if you need help setting up and optimising your task management workflow.
Some apps are known for their exceptional UI/UX:
Any.do: Features a clean, minimalist interface with a focus on simplicity and ease of use.
Todoist: Offers a customisable interface with a variety of themes and options to tailor the app to your preferences.
Trello: Uses a Kanban-style board system that is visually appealing and easy to understand.
Integration with Other Productivity Tools
Task management apps often integrate with other productivity tools to streamline workflows and enhance efficiency. Consider the app's compatibility with the tools you already use, such as calendars, email clients, and communication platforms.
Calendar Integration: Syncing your task management app with your calendar allows you to view tasks alongside appointments and deadlines, providing a comprehensive overview of your schedule.
Email Integration: Integrating with email clients enables you to create tasks directly from emails, ensuring important requests and reminders are captured. Many apps offer direct integrations with Gmail and Outlook.
Communication Platform Integration: Connecting with communication platforms like Slack allows you to receive task notifications, share updates, and collaborate with team members seamlessly. Check the frequently asked questions to see if your preferred apps integrate well together.
File Storage Integration: Integration with cloud storage services like Google Drive and Dropbox enables you to attach relevant files to tasks, providing easy access to supporting documents.
Here are some common integrations:
Todoist: Integrates with Google Calendar, Outlook Calendar, Gmail, Slack, and Zapier.
Asana: Integrates with Google Calendar, Outlook Calendar, Slack, Microsoft Teams, and Zoom.
Trello: Integrates with Google Drive, Dropbox, Slack, and Jira.
Google Tasks: Integrates seamlessly with Google Calendar and Gmail.
Microsoft To Do: Integrates with Outlook Calendar, Microsoft Planner, and Microsoft Teams.
Any.do: Integrates with Google Calendar, Outlook Calendar, WhatsApp, and Slack.
Mobile Accessibility and Offline Functionality
Mobile accessibility is crucial for managing tasks on the go. The app should offer a seamless experience on both Android and iOS devices, with intuitive navigation and responsive design. Offline functionality allows you to view and manage tasks even without an internet connection.
Cross-Platform Compatibility: The app should be available on both Android and iOS platforms, with consistent features and functionality across devices.
Responsive Design: The app's interface should adapt to different screen sizes and orientations, ensuring a comfortable user experience on smartphones and tablets.
Offline Functionality: The ability to view and manage tasks offline is essential for users who frequently work in areas with limited internet connectivity. Changes made offline should automatically sync when a connection is restored.
Most of the top task management apps offer excellent mobile accessibility and offline functionality. However, it's always a good idea to test the app on your specific devices to ensure it meets your needs. Consider what's important to you and what we offer to help you stay productive.
By carefully considering these factors, you can choose the task management app that best suits your individual needs and preferences, ultimately boosting your productivity and helping you stay organised.